How to Style Leopard Print for Upholstery Like a Pro
1. Start Small with Accent Pieces
For leopard print newbies, try
-
A single statement armchairin a living room
-
Bar stools with leopard-print seatsfor kitchen islands
-
Ottomans or footstoolsthat add playful texture
2. Create Luxe Layer Effects
Elevate your leopard pieces by
-
Pairing with rich textureslike mohair throws and silk cushions
-
Combining with metallic accentsin brass or gold
-
Balancing with solid coloursin deep greens or navy blues
3. Unexpected Applications
Beyond furniture, consider:
-
Leopard-print stair runnersfor dramatic impact
-
Headboard upholsteryin a bedroom scheme
-
Dining chair seatsfor dinner party conversation starters
4. Colour Pairings That Work
Modern leopard print comes in versatile hues:
-
Black and whitefor contemporary edge
-
Camel tonesfor timeless elegance
-
Dusty pinksfor feminine charm
